Bill Clinton Testifies Before Congressional Committee Denying Knowledge of Jeffrey Epstein's Crimes

Former U.S. President Bill Clinton stated on Friday, February 27, 2026, that he knew nothing about the crimes that sex offender Jeffrey Epstein is alleged to have committed. During his opening statements before a congressional committee, Clinton claimed he did nothing wrong, as reported by EFE. Clinton stated: I had no idea of the crimes Epstein was committing. No matter how many photos you show me, there are two things that, in the end, matter more than your interpretation of those photos from 20 years ago. I know what I saw and, more importantly, what I did not see. I know what I did and, more importantly, what I did not do.
